For the three months ended June 30, 2014, Laclede reported consolidated net income of $11.7 million, up from $6.6 million for the third quarter a year ago. Net economic earnings (NEE) increased to $14.5 million from $8.2 million. NEE excludes from net income the effect of unrealized gains and losses on energy-related derivatives, as well as integration and transaction costs associated with acquisition, divestiture and restructuring activities, as detailed below. The $6.3 million increase in NEE was driven by higher earnings from both the Gas Utility and Gas Marketing segments. On a per-share basis, NEE was $0.44 per fully diluted share for the third quarter of 2014, compared to $0.36 per share a year ago. NEE per share exclude the addition of approximately 10 million common shares issued in both June 2014 and May 2013 to finance a portion of the acquisitions of Alagasco and Missouri Gas Energy (MGE), respectively.
Gas Utility
For the third quarter, the Gas Utility segment reported net economic earnings of $13.3 million, up from $6.8 million a year earlier. Net income was $12.1 million compared to $6.8 million in the prior year. The increase was primarily due to a $52.4 million (or 74%) improvement in operating margin (non-GAAP; see "Operating Margin and Reconciliation to GAAP") driven by:
$48.9 million due to the addition of MGE’s operating results in 2014
$2.4 million related to higher rates including surcharges for infrastructure investment
$1.1 million from higher consumption and modest customer growth
Other operating expenses increased by $34.9 million, reflecting $31.6 million from the inclusion of MGE. The remainder reflected higher operating, maintenance, bad debt and labor costs, associated in part with the follow-on impacts of the extreme winter weather. Depreciation and amortization expenses increased by $6.9 million from the prior year, with $5.9 million due to the addition of MGE and the remainder reflecting infrastructure investments over the last year.
Gas Marketing
The Gas Marketing segment includes the results of Laclede Energy Resources, which provides non-regulated natural gas marketing services to the Midwest region. Quarterly net economic earnings were $1.9 million, up from $1.6 million in the prior year period, while net income increased to $3.0 million from $1.4 million. Results for Gas Marketing are largely driven by opportunities created by price volatility and basis differentials (pricing differences between supply regions). Operating margin for the third quarter improved to $6.5 million, an increase of $3.3 million over the prior-year period, as market conditions were generally more favorable this quarter compared to 2013, due in large part to the carryover of market conditions driven by the extreme cold winter.

For the first nine months of fiscal 2014, Laclede reported consolidated net economic earnings of $102.5 million compared to $68.9 million in the prior year. Net income was $99.5 million, up from $62.4 million in 2013. The increase in earnings was driven principally by higher Gas Utility and Gas Marketing operating results, particularly in the second quarter which had significant benefit from colder than normal winter weather. On a per-share basis, NEE was $3.12 per fully diluted share for the nine months ended June 30, 2014, compared to $3.04 per share in the prior-year period.
Gas Utility
For the first nine months of fiscal 2014, the Gas Utility segment reported NEE of $93.8 million, up 51 percent from $62.3 million for the same period in 2013. Segment net income was $91.6 million, up from $62.3 million a year ago. The increase was primarily due to a $175.7 million improvement in operating margin, of which $156.2 million is attributable to the addition of MGE in the current year. The unusually cold winter in the second quarter of fiscal 2014 contributed $6.5 million to operating margin. Other operating expenses increased by $96.3 million, of which $83.4 million reflects the inclusion of MGE, reflecting higher costs for maintenance, bad debt and labor associated with the unusually cold winter, which essentially offset the additional operating margin. Depreciation and amortization expenses increased by $24.8 million, with $21.2 million attributable to MGE and the remainder reflecting higher capital investments.
Gas Marketing
For the nine months ended June 30, 2014, Gas Marketing NEE was $9.8 million, up 34 percent from $7.3 million a year ago. Net income increased to $12.9 million from $6.1 million a year ago. The earnings increase was largely attributable to higher weather-related operating margins in the second quarter of $9.0 million (a benefit to earnings of approximately $5.6 million or $0.17 per share). Run rate margins declined from the prior year, reflecting the expiration of two favorable gas supply contracts during 2013 and early 2014.
 
ACQUISITIONS
Missouri Gas Energy
Since closing the acquisition in the fourth quarter of fiscal 2013, the Company has incurred one-time costs associated with the integration of MGE. For the third quarter and fiscal year to date, those costs totaled $1.2 million and $4.6 million respectively. Under the regulatory order approving the acquisition of MGE, Laclede defers for future rate recovery 50 percent of these one-time integration costs, resulting in a deferral of $0.6 million and $2.3 million, respectively. The after-tax impacts of the net one-time integration costs were $0.4 million and $1.4 million, respectively.

In the prior-year period, acquisition-related costs, principally due diligence and transaction costs associated with the then-pending MGE acquisition, were $2.2 million for the third quarter and $8.5 million for the first nine months, or an after-tax earnings impact of $1.4 million and $5.3 million, respectively. The after-tax impact of both transaction and net one-time integration costs for all periods is reflected in GAAP results, and is excluded for net economic earnings as noted in the reconciliation.

Alagasco
As announced on April 7, 2014, Laclede entered into an agreement with Energen Corporation to acquire 100 percent of the common stock of Alagasco for $1.6 billion including the assumption of $250 million in Alagasco debt. The transaction is subject to customary closing conditions, including obtaining required approvals. Laclede received clearance under the Hart-Scott-Rodino Antitrust Improvements Act on May 7. On July 22, the Alabama Public Service Commission (APSC) unanimously voted to approve Laclede’s acquisition of Alagasco, and subsequently issued a written order reflecting their decision effective July 24. Pursuant to Alabama law, parties have 30 days to appeal an order of the APSC. No party to the proceeding before the APSC formally opposed the application for approval. Assuming completion of the appeal period, Laclede is targeting an August 31 effective close on the transaction.


3



The Company incurred costs associated with the evaluation and negotiation of the Alagasco transaction totaling $4.2 million in the third quarter and $6.1 million for the first nine months of fiscal 2014, which had an after-tax earnings impact of $2.7 million and $3.9 million, respectively. The Company expects to incur total transaction-related costs, including interest costs associated with the equity units and long-term debt issued to finance the acquisition, in the range of $18 million to $22 million. As with the costs incurred for the MGE acquisition noted above, the after-tax impact of these costs is reflected in GAAP results, and is excluded for net economic earnings as noted in the reconciliation.

The Alagasco acquisition is supported by a fully-syndicated bridge facility with Credit Suisse, Wells Fargo Bank, N.A., and a group of eleven additional financial institutions, originally totaling $1.35 billion. On June 11, Laclede successfully completed the equity portion of the permanent transaction financing, generating net proceeds of approximately $600 million through the issuance of common stock and equity units. As previously announced, Laclede issued 10.35 million shares of common stock at $46.25 per share and 2.875 million equity units at $50 per unit. Largely due to Laclede's receipt of the proceeds from those offerings, the bridge facility was reduced to $700 million effective June 16.

The remaining permanent financing is expected to include the issuance of approximately $625 million of Laclede long-term debt, the assumption of the existing Alagasco debt, the use of corporate cash and revolving credit borrowing. Laclede has interest rate hedges covering a majority of its anticipated long-term debt issuance.

REGULATORY UPDATE
Laclede Gas
As reported previously, the Missouri Public Service Commission (MoPSC) approved the establishment of an Infrastructure System Replacement Surcharge (ISRS) of $7.0 million annually, effective April 12, 2014, increasing the monthly bill for the average residential customer by $0.86. The ISRS revenues allow Laclede Gas to recover the investment it has made in upgrading its distribution system to improve safety and reliability, and to reduce future operating costs.

On July 25, Laclede Gas filed for an additional ISRS of $3.1 million annually, covering additional investments in its distribution system since the last surcharge noted above. The filing is subject to review by the MoPSC.

Missouri Gas Energy
On July 25, MGE filed to establish a new ISRS rider of $2.8 million annually, covering investments since January 2014. As with the Laclede Gas filing, it is subject to review and approval by the MoPSC.

BALANCE SHEETS AND CASH FLOWS
The balance sheets for Laclede as of June 30, 2014 and September 30, 2013 reflect the acquisition of MGE, including the addition of its assets and liabilities and the equity and debt issued to finance the acquisition which closed on September 1, 2013. The June 30, 2014 balance sheet also reflects the issuance of 10.35 million shares of common stock and 2.875 million in equity units in June 2014 to support the Alagasco acquisition. The balance sheet as of June 30, 2013 includes 10.0 million shares of common stock issued in May 2013 in anticipation of the closing of the then-pending MGE acquisition.

The Company strives to maintain a strong long-term capital structure and is targeting approximately 51 percent long-term debt to total capitalization upon the completion of the Alagasco transaction. Laclede had no short-term borrowings outstanding at June 30, 2014 compared to $74.0 million at September 30, 2013.

Net cash provided by operating activities was $185.0 million for the nine months ended June 30, 2014, up from $167.0 million for the prior year period. On this comparative basis, the main drivers of higher cash inflows in the nine months ended June 30, 2014 were higher net income, a higher sendout of natural gas stored underground,

4



and higher depreciation, amortization, and accretion reflecting the inclusion of MGE. These cash inflows were partially offset by the seasonality of the accounts receivable balance and delayed customer billings.

Capital expenditures for the nine months ended June 30, 2014 increased to $109.5 million from $96.8 million in the prior year period, primarily due to increased investment in pipeline replacement driven by the addition of MGE.

This news release includes the non-GAAP financial measures of "net economic earnings," "net economic earnings per share," and “operating margin.” Management also uses these non-GAAP measures internally when evaluating the Company's performance and results of operations. Net economic earnings exclude from net income the after-tax impacts of fair value accounting and timing adjustments associated with energy-related transactions. These adjustments, which primarily impact the Gas Marketing segment, include net unrealized gains and losses on energy-related derivatives resulting from the current changes in the fair value of financial and physical transactions prior to their completion and settlement, lower of cost or market inventory adjustments, and realized gains and losses on economic hedges prior to the sale of the physical commodity. In calculating net economic earnings, management also excludes from net income the after-tax impacts related to acquisition, divestiture, and restructuring activities, including one-time costs related to the integration of MGE and costs related to the acquisition of Alabama Gas Corporation. Management believes that excluding these items provides a useful representation of the economic impact of actual settled transactions and overall results of ongoing operations. Operating margin adjusts operating income to include only those costs that are directly passed on to the customers and collected through revenues, which are the wholesale cost of natural gas and propane and gross receipts taxes. These internal non-GAAP operating metrics should not be considered as an alternative to, or more meaningful than, GAAP measures such as operating income or net income.
